During july, stan's sporting goods recorded $184,655 sales on account. the sales tax rate is 7.5%. 22) referring to table 3, what is the amount of the sales tax, rounded to the nearest dollar? 22)
a. $17,806
b. $13,849
c. $11,079
d. $12,926

184655 * 7.5%
= 184655 * 0.075
= 13849.125
= $13,849 (B)
